What Is AI Video from Script Online?
An AI video from script online platform is a specialized tool that leverages large language models (LLMs) and video generation models to interpret a written script and produce a corresponding video. The process typically involves three stages: first, the AI parses the script to understand the narrative arc, character dialogues, and scene changes; second, it generates or selects visual assets (e.g., using a library of licensed stock footage, AI-rendered 3D scenes, or animated characters); and third, it compiles the assets with a synthetic voiceover, background music, and transitions to create a seamless clip. In 2026, these tools have advanced to support cinematic parameters such as camera angles, lighting effects, and shot composition.

How to Turn Text into Cinematic Clips: A Step-by-Step Guide

Using an AI video from script online tool is straightforward)Skip. Follow these steps to transform your written script into a cinematic clip that rivals traditional productions.
- Write or paste your script. Start with a clear, well-structured script. Most tools accept plain text, but some allow you to upload a screenplay format (.fountain, .pdf) or a storyboard. For best results, break your script into short scenes (30–60 seconds each) and include visual cues like “close-up on face” or “wide shot of city.”
- Choose your video style and genre. Select from presets such as “cinematic,” “documentary,” “animation,” or “tutorial.” In 2026, many AI video generators offer style transfer from reference images or even from a short sample video you provide. For example, if you want a noir film look, the AI will apply appropriate color grading and lighting.
- Customize characters and voiceover. Pick a synthetic voice that matches your script’s tone—options range from calm narrators to energetic presenters. Some platforms allow you to clone a real voice (with consent) or use AI-generated celebrity voices. You can also adjust pacing, pitch, and emotion.
- Review and refine the generated video. After the AI processes your script, you’ll receive a draft video. Use the built-in editor to swap scenes, adjust timing, or add text overlays. Many tools now offer real-time preview so you can tweak parameters without waiting for a full re-render.
- Export and share. Once satisfied, export your video in 4K or even 8K resolution, depending on your subscription. Most platforms directly integrate with YouTube, TikTok, Instagram, and ad networks. You can also download the video file for offline use or further editing in professional software.

Ethical Considerations and Quality Control
While AI video from script online tools are powerful, they also raise important ethical questions. In March 2026, Undark Magazine published an investigation titled “AI Slop Is Infiltrating Online Children’s Content,” warning that low-effort AI-generated videos—often nonsensical or bizarre—are flooding platforms like YouTube Kids. These videos can confuse young viewers and even expose them to inappropriate themes if the AI misinterprets a script. As a responsible creator, you should always review the final output for accuracy, tone, and safety, especially when targeting children.
Furthermore, the ease of generating videos from scripts has led to concerns about copyright and originality. Many AI tools train on vast datasets that include copyrighted material, leading to potential infringement. In 2026, several lawsuits are pending against major AI video providers. To protect yourself, use only royalty-free scripts or your own original writing, and check the tool’s licensing terms before commercial use.
Finally, quality control remains paramount. Even the best AI video generators can produce “slop”—jerky animations, unnatural voiceovers, or mismatched visuals. The 23 tools tested by Perfectcorp.com had an average error rate of 12% per clip, meaning you should budget time for manual corrections. Always export a draft and run it through a human review before publishing.

How long does it take to generate a video from a script?
Processing time depends on script length and tool complexity. A 60-second script typically takes 2–5 minutes to generate. Longer scripts (10 minutes) may take 15–30 minutes. In 2026, many platforms offer background rendering so you can work on other tasks while the video is being created.
Can I use my own voice or video clips with AI video generators?
Yes, many tools allow you to upload custom voice recordings (for voice cloning) and video footage (to blend with AI-generated scenes). This hybrid approach often yields the most authentic results. Check the tool’s upload limits and supported formats (usually MP4, WAV, or MP3).

How do I avoid AI slop when using these tools?
Start with a well-written, specific script. Avoid vague descriptions like “a beautiful landscape” and instead say “a sunset over a calm ocean with gentle waves.” Use the tool’s style presets and manually adjust scene transitions. Always preview the generated video frame-by-frame for any jarring elements. If the output looks like slop, tweak the script or try a different tool.
